Home
last modified time | relevance | path

Searched refs:guid_string (Results 1 – 25 of 26) sorted by relevance

12

/linux-6.14.4/drivers/platform/x86/
Dwmi.c118 while (*id->guid_string) { in find_guid_context()
119 if (guid_parse_and_compare(id->guid_string, &wblock->gblock.guid)) in find_guid_context()
187 static struct wmi_device *wmi_find_device_by_guid(const char *guid_string) in wmi_find_device_by_guid() argument
193 ret = guid_parse(guid_string, &guid); in wmi_find_device_by_guid()
221 int wmi_instance_count(const char *guid_string) in wmi_instance_count() argument
226 wdev = wmi_find_device_by_guid(guid_string); in wmi_instance_count()
265 acpi_status wmi_evaluate_method(const char *guid_string, u8 instance, u32 method_id, in wmi_evaluate_method() argument
271 wdev = wmi_find_device_by_guid(guid_string); in wmi_evaluate_method()
413 acpi_status wmi_query_block(const char *guid_string, u8 instance, in wmi_query_block() argument
420 wdev = wmi_find_device_by_guid(guid_string); in wmi_query_block()
[all …]
Dhuawei-wmi.c785 { .guid_string = WMI0_EVENT_GUID },
786 { .guid_string = HWMI_EVENT_GUID },
798 while (*guid->guid_string) { in huawei_wmi_probe()
799 if (wmi_has_guid(guid->guid_string)) { in huawei_wmi_probe()
800 err = huawei_wmi_input_setup(&pdev->dev, guid->guid_string); in huawei_wmi_probe()
802 dev_err(&pdev->dev, "Failed to setup input on %s\n", guid->guid_string); in huawei_wmi_probe()
826 while (*guid->guid_string) { in huawei_wmi_remove()
827 if (wmi_has_guid(guid->guid_string)) in huawei_wmi_remove()
828 huawei_wmi_input_exit(&pdev->dev, guid->guid_string); in huawei_wmi_remove()
Dwmi-bmof.c86 { .guid_string = WMI_BMOF_GUID },
Dxiaomi-wmi.c20 .guid_string = (guid), \
Dnvidia-wmi-ec-backlight.c127 { .guid_string = WMI_BRIGHTNESS_GUID },
Dlenovo-wmi-camera.c126 { .guid_string = WMI_LENOVO_CAMERABUTTON_EVENT_GUID },
Dlenovo-ymc.c146 { .guid_string = LENOVO_YMC_EVENT_GUID },
Dinspur_platform_profile.c200 { .guid_string = WMI_INSPUR_POWERMODE_BIOS_GUID },
Dthink-lmi.c352 static int tlmi_setting(int item, char **value, const char *guid_string) in tlmi_setting() argument
358 status = wmi_query_block(guid_string, item, &output); in tlmi_setting()
1800 { .guid_string = LENOVO_BIOS_SETTING_GUID },
/linux-6.14.4/drivers/platform/x86/dell/dell-wmi-sysman/
Dsysman.c289 union acpi_object *get_wmiobj_pointer(int instance_id, const char *guid_string) in get_wmiobj_pointer() argument
294 status = wmi_query_block(guid_string, instance_id, &out); in get_wmiobj_pointer()
303 int get_instance_count(const char *guid_string) in get_instance_count() argument
307 ret = wmi_instance_count(guid_string); in get_instance_count()
Ddell-wmi-sysman.h158 union acpi_object *get_wmiobj_pointer(int instance_id, const char *guid_string);
159 int get_instance_count(const char *guid_string);
Dpasswordattr-interface.c130 { .guid_string = DELL_WMI_BIOS_PASSWORD_INTERFACE_GUID },
Dbiosattr-interface.c163 { .guid_string = DELL_WMI_BIOS_ATTRIBUTES_INTERFACE_GUID },
/linux-6.14.4/drivers/platform/x86/intel/wmi/
Dthunderbolt.c56 { .guid_string = INTEL_WMI_THUNDERBOLT_GUID },
Dsbl-fw-update.c121 { .guid_string = INTEL_WMI_SBL_GUID },
/linux-6.14.4/drivers/platform/x86/hp/hp-bioscfg/
Dbioscfg.c375 union acpi_object *hp_get_wmiobj_pointer(int instance_id, const char *guid_string) in hp_get_wmiobj_pointer() argument
380 status = wmi_query_block(guid_string, instance_id, &out); in hp_get_wmiobj_pointer()
389 int hp_get_instance_count(const char *guid_string) in hp_get_instance_count() argument
396 wmi_obj = hp_get_wmiobj_pointer(i, guid_string); in hp_get_instance_count()
Dbioscfg.h479 union acpi_object *hp_get_wmiobj_pointer(int instance_id, const char *guid_string);
480 int hp_get_instance_count(const char *guid_string);
Dbiosattr-interface.c289 { .guid_string = HP_WMI_BIOS_GUID},
/linux-6.14.4/drivers/platform/x86/dell/
Ddell-wmi-descriptor.c187 { .guid_string = DELL_WMI_DESCRIPTOR_GUID },
Ddell-wmi-privacy.c379 { .guid_string = DELL_PRIVACY_GUID },
Ddell-smbios-wmi.c293 { .guid_string = DELL_WMI_SMBIOS_GUID },
Ddell-wmi-base.c806 { .guid_string = DELL_EVENT_GUID },
/linux-6.14.4/scripts/mod/
Dfile2alias.c1246 DEF_FIELD_ADDR(symval, wmi_device_id, guid_string); in do_wmi_entry()
1248 if (strlen(*guid_string) != UUID_STRING_LEN) { in do_wmi_entry()
1250 *guid_string, mod->name); in do_wmi_entry()
1254 module_alias_printf(mod, false, WMI_MODULE_PREFIX "%s", *guid_string); in do_wmi_entry()
Ddevicetable-offsets.c245 DEVID_FIELD(wmi_device_id, guid_string); in main()
/linux-6.14.4/include/linux/
Dmod_devicetable.h849 const char guid_string[UUID_STRING_LEN+1]; member

12